Do You Need to Be Good at Math to Be a Software Engineer?

TLDRNo, you don't have to be great at math to be a software engineer. However, logical reasoning is important in all areas of software engineering.

Key insights

💡There are different types of software engineering jobs, and the level of math required varies across these roles.

🔢Game engineers often use math to model the laws of Physics in their games.

📚Most universities require college-level math classes as prerequisites for advanced computer science courses.

🧠Logical reasoning is a crucial skill in all software engineering jobs.

🎯A strong foundation in math can be important for certain software engineering careers, but not for all.

Q&A

Do I need to be good at math to become a software engineer?

No, being great at math is not a requirement for becoming a software engineer. However, logical reasoning is important in all areas of software engineering.

Are there specific software engineering jobs that require extensive math skills?

Some software engineering jobs, like game engineering, may require extensive math skills for tasks such as modeling physics in games. However, there are also software engineering jobs that require very little math.

Do I need to study math in college to become a software engineer?

Most universities do require college-level math classes as prerequisites for advanced computer science courses. However, the level of math required for day-to-day software engineering jobs can vary.

Can I succeed as a software engineer without strong math skills?

Yes, you can succeed as a software engineer without strong math skills. While a strong foundation in math can be beneficial, logical reasoning and problem-solving skills are often more important in software engineering.

What is the most important math-related skill for software engineers?

The most important math-related skill for software engineers is logical reasoning. Being able to reason logically is crucial for reading, writing, and fixing code.

Timestamped Summary

00:00The video begins with the creator greeting the audience and announcing their return to full force after being away.

00:08The creator addresses a common question: Do you need to be good at math to be a software engineer?

00:37The creator emphasizes that while math may not be required, logical reasoning is important in all areas of software engineering.

01:07The creator explains that different software engineering jobs have different math requirements.

01:47Game engineers, for example, often use math to model the laws of Physics in their games.

02:30The creator discusses the math courses typically required in computer science degrees.

03:13While math can be important for certain software engineering careers, it may not be necessary for others.

03:36Logical reasoning is highlighted as the most important math-related skill for software engineers.